ZIP 19536 and ZIP 19540 are ZIP Code areas in Pennsylvania.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 19540 has the higher population (11,705 vs 490 in ZIP 19536). ZIP 19540 has the higher median household income ($96,066 vs $53,750 in ZIP 19536). ZIP 19540 has the higher median home value ($290,500 vs $170,200 in ZIP 19536).
